Understanding the Fundamentals of Plinko
At its core, plinko is a vertical game board populated with numerous pegs. These pegs are arranged in a staggered pattern, creating a network of potential pathways for the descending puck. The puck, typically a flat disc, is released from a slot at the top, and gravity does the rest. As the puck falls, it bounces off the pegs, changing direction with each collision. The angle of impact and the precise arrangement of the pegs dictate the final destination: one of the prize slots located at the base of the board. Each slot is assigned a different monetary value, offering a range of potential payouts. The broader the base, the more spread out the potential outcomes will be, and increasing the odds that a puck will land in a lower value slot. The narrower the board, the higher the concentration of potential value and risk for larger rewards.
The inherent randomness is what makes plinko so captivating. Despite the predictability of gravity, the multitude of possible bounces creates an almost infinite number of trajectories. This unpredictability is further compounded by the slight variations in peg placement and the initial release point of the puck. Therefore, it is not a game where skill guarantees success, but rather where understanding the underlying probabilities can inform a player’s approach. Players should note that while chance dominates, smart bankroll management and an awareness of the board's layout are crucial components of any sensible strategy. A board with more slots generally means lower average payouts per slot, while a smaller number of slots might offer higher potential rewards but with much lower probabilities.
The Role of Probability in Plinko Outcomes
While each bounce appears random, probabilities dictate the likelihood of the puck landing in specific slots. The slots positioned directly below the starting point have a higher probability of receiving the puck, as fewer deflections are needed for it to reach them. Conversely, slots further to the sides require more bounces and therefore have a lower probability. However, this isn't a linear relationship; the distribution isn't uniform. The arrangement of pegs introduces complexities, meaning that some side slots might be more accessible than others. Understanding this nuanced distribution is key to developing any kind of informed strategy, and often requires observing several rounds of play to discern patterns. It's important to recognize that the game is designed to have a house edge, meaning that, over the long run, the casino will always come out ahead.

Leveraging Online Plinko Variations
The digital age has brought about numerous variations of plinko, each with its own unique features and gameplay mechanics. Online platforms often offer a wider range of boards with different payout structures, themes, and bonus features. Some versions implement multipliers that can significantly increase potential winnings, while others introduce additional challenges or objectives. These variations greatly enhance the strategic depth of the game, offering more opportunities for calculated risks and potential rewards. Some online platforms even allow you to customize the board’s characteristics, to a certain extent, letting you adjust parameters like the number of pegs or payout multipliers.
Furthermore, online plinko often includes features like automated betting, which allows players to set a series of bets in advance, and detailed statistics tracking, providing valuable insights into their gameplay. These tools can be particularly useful for analyzing patterns and refining strategies. It's important to note that the random number generators (RNGs) used in online plinko should be certified by independent testing agencies to ensure fairness and transparency. Reputable online casinos will prominently display these certifications, assuring players that the game is not rigged or manipulated. Always ensure you're playing on a licensed and regulated platform to protect your funds and personal information.
